Honda/Acura NSX - Key Specifications
Specification | Details |
---|---|
Type | Hybrid Supercar |
Released At | 2016 Model Year |
Built At | Marysville, Ohio, USA |
Engine | 3.5L Twin-Turbocharged V6 + Three Electric Motors |
Position | Mid-Engine, Longitudinal |
Aspiration | Twin-Turbocharged |
Block Material | Aluminum Alloy |
Valvetrain | DOHC, 4 Valves per Cylinder |
Fuel Feed | Direct Fuel Injection |
Displacement | 3493 cc / 213.2 in³ |
Bore | 91 mm / 3.58 in |
Stroke | 89.5 mm / 3.52 in |
Compression | 10.0:1 |
Power | 573 hp / 427 kW @ 6500-7500 rpm |
Specific Output | 163.9 hp per liter |
BHP/Weight | Varies |
Torque | 645 Nm / 476 lb-ft @ 2000-6000 rpm |
Top Speed | 307 km/h / 191 mph |
0 – 60 mph | 2.9 seconds |
0 – 100 km/h | 3.1 seconds |
Body / Frame | Aluminum and Carbon Fiber Monocoque |
Driven Wheels | AWD (Super Handling All-Wheel Drive) |
Wheel Type | Forged Aluminum Alloy Wheels |
Front Tires | 245/35ZR19 |
Rear Tires | 305/30ZR20 |
Front Brakes | Ventilated Carbon Ceramic Discs with 6-Piston Brembo Calipers |
Rear Brakes | Ventilated Carbon Ceramic Discs with 4-Piston Brembo Calipers |
Front Wheels | 19 x 8.5 in |
Rear Wheels | 20 x 11 in |
Front Suspension | Double Wishbone with Adaptive Dampers |
Rear Suspension | Multi-Link with Adaptive Dampers |
Curb Weight | 1725 kg / 3803 lbs |
Weight Distribution | 42 % Front / 58 % Rear |
Wheelbase | 2630 mm / 103.5 in |
Length | 4470 mm / 176.0 in |
Width | 1940 mm / 76.4 in |
Height | 1204 mm / 47.4 in |
Transmission | 9-Speed Dual-Clutch Automatic |
Fuel Economy (Combined) | 10.3 L/100 km or 23 mpg-US |
Fuel Capacity | 59 liters / 15.6 gallons |
The second-gen NSX blends a 3.5L twin-turbo V6 (500hp) with three electric motors for 573hp combined.
A tech marvel, but its hybrid complexity creates unique depreciation patterns.
